Address

DP3sDFCqd6s1T2bkUXzEe2H6f9NEpAtRqHCopy

Total Received

5.31660413 DOGE

Total Sent

5.20996413 DOGE

№ Transactions

3

Final Balance

0.10664 DOGE

Transactions
Filter